The USB-TC features eight, 24-bit analog inputs for precise thermocouple measurements, 2 S/s/ch sample rate, and 8 digital I/O.

The USB-TEMP features eight, 24-bit analog inputs for precise thermocouple measurements, 2 S/s/ch sample rate, and 8 digital I/O that supports thermocouple, RTD, thermistor, and semiconductor sensor types.

The USB-TEMP-AI also features eight, 24-bit analog inputs and a 2 S/s/ch sample rate. Four channels can be configured to measure various temperature sensors including thermocouples, RTDs, thermistors, and semiconductor sensors. The last four channels are capable of measuring voltage and offer the following input ranges; ±10, ±5, ±2.5, ±1.25 V. Eight digital I/O and one counter input are also provided.

Software support includes DAQami, an out-of-the-box application for data logging, visualization, and signal generation. Data can be viewed in real-time or post-acquisition on user-configurable displays. Drivers are included for the most popular applications and programming languages including Visual C++®, Visual C#®, Visual Basic®.NET, DASYLab®, LabVIEW, MATLAB®, Linux®, and Python.

Prioritizing on ease of use and flexibility, MCC offers out-of-the-box software plus drivers for the most popular programming languages and applications.

Out-of-the-box software includes DAQami for data logging, visualization, and signal generation. For a more full-featured and customizable experience, DASYLab® provides real-time analysis and control, plus the ability to create custom applications without programming.

DAQami is an out-of-the-box application for data logging, visualization, and signal generation. Data can be viewed in real-time or post-acquisition on user-configurable displays. DAQami is ideal for interactive testing, data logging, and developing applications that run for minutes or days.
